What are the height and setback rules for a fence on my property line?
Browns Mills zoning limits fences to 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ear/side yards, with a 0-foot setback allowed on the property line. For corner lots, especially near NJ-70, a 'sight triangle' must remain clear of visual obstructions. We survey this during the consultation to ensure compliance and driver visibility.
Which fencing materials hold up best to Browns Mills soil and pests?
Given the moderate soil corrosivity index and moderate-to-heavy termite risk, material compatibility is critical. Pressure-treated pine, cedar, or composite materials perform well. We use hot-dip galvanized or stainless steel fasteners to prevent rust streaks and premature failure from soil moisture and salt.
Why do fence posts in Browns Mills Center need deep concrete footings?
The 30-inch frost line depth here requires footings extending below this depth. Posts set in shallow concrete will heave upward during winter freeze-thaw cycles, breaking the structure. We follow IRC standards for post stability, which mandates this depth to prevent failure.
What is required before you start digging?
State law requires contacting New Jersey 811 to mark all underground utility lines at least three business days before excavation. Hitting a gas, water, or fiber line in Browns Mills Center is a major liability causing service disruption and costly repairs. We manage the 811 process and coordinate with the local permit office to secure all required approvals before any equipment arrives.
Can I add a smart gate to my pool fence?
Yes. Integrating a smart gate with IoT-controlled latches is a moderate trend that can enhance security and meet modern liability standards. The system must still comply fully with NJ's pool safety code (IRC Appendix AG), which mandates self-closing, self-latching mechanisms out of a child's reach. We ensure the integrated hardware meets both sets of requirements.
How do you design a fence to withstand high winds here?
The 115 MPH V-ult wind speed rating dictates the structural design. We calculate wind pressure per ASCE 7-22 standards to determine post spacing, concrete footing mass, and bracket strength. This engineering ensures the fence can survive peak storm season gusts without panels becoming airborne projectiles.
